Everyone wants to know how to treat cellulite. But to effectively get rid of it, one must get to the root of the problem and know exactly what causes it. Heredity, lifestyle, poor blood circulation, diet and gender are considered major factors in the formation of cellulite in the body. The promise of a cure is much too attractive to pass for women who are desperately seeking a solution to the problem. But what creams do actually work? Checking the active ingredients contained in the creams is an essential thing that has to be done. For instance, it is well known that caffeine is an all natural cellulite fighter and most cellulite creams contain this ingredient. Aminophylline (an asthma medication) as an active ingredient in cellulite creams has been proven to be an effective cure when used topically. It is found in the top selling brands of cellulite creams today. But what can work for one may not necessarily work for another.

Some practical tips on how to treat cellulite that you can do at home, are as follows:

1. Have a coffee wrap or coffee scrub

Heat some coffee beans. Place in a plastic wrap or cloth and wrap around the cellulite area. Leave on for 10 to 15 minutes. The warm coffee beans open up the pores in the skin which help the caffeine to absorb in. You can also rub ground coffee into the skin for about a minute before you take a shower. Coffee scrubs in most spas worldwide go by this principle. Coffee has been proven to reduce the swelling of fat cells thereby making the skin smoother.

2. Have regular massages

Massaging is an effective remedy for cellulite. It breaks down the fat cells and increases blood circulation. Regular massages could be a luxury for some. In cases where regular massages are impossible, Dry Brushing could be an alternative. A shower brush with soft bristles is the perfect tool to achieve this. A daily 10 minute brush to the cellulite area is required. This improves blood circulation and tones the muscles as well.
